All information from the talks between the troika and IMF with the Greek government lead to the conclusion that the agreement signed between all parties must be implemented. There may be some deviation from the budget surplus that must be achieved over the next years, but it is clear that to achieve this additional measures are necessary, more than what the government can handle.

Based on the beliefs within the government, the only way to find this additional revenue is to impose new taxes and carry out any acceptable pension cuts. The few employees who earn more than 30,000 euros will be called to pay for the government’s inability to tidy up the state sector.

Because, as everyone knows, not only are no efforts made to reconstruct the state mechanism, reduce bureaucracy which only aims to torment the people, but we carry on appointing anyone we can, the only criteria and skill necessary being the devotion to the leader and past experience with the party…

The one-time middle class has only been crushed, tax evasion is uncurbed despite the government cries, but the recipe remains the same. In the name of protecting the vulnerable and equality, the dominant leftist obsessions bring upon the collapse of society and forced adaptation to a living standard that differs very little from poverty.

It is clear that the country’s real fiscal problem is not primarily financial, but rather political. It is the political inability to accept and push forward the necessary reforms and build the necessary social consent, so that we ma finally overcome the current impasse. It is no coincidence that we are the only country in a bailout program and after six years we have not only left it behind, but we are finally reaching rock bottom…
